About the company

Ljunghäll is owned by the Italian Gnutti Carlo SPA and together we form a global player with over 4,000 employees in Sweden, Italy, Germany, Czech Republic, United Kingdom, Austria, India, China, USA, and Canada. Ljunghäll die-casts aluminum components for the automotive industry and in our niche, Ljunghäll is the leading company in Northern Europe. Our parent company, Gnutti Carlo, is a world leader in the development and delivery of robust and high-performance valve control and fuel injection components for construction, agricultural, marine, generator, and transport engines.
